Transaction 8fd5661460b95392cce5bb2f8c39a32e2583afaf66f410c4f05ed918d721a92a
1 Input
1 Output
-
8fd5661460b95392cce5bb2f8c39a32e2583afaf66f410c4f05ed918d721a92a:0
- value
- 534800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4254ea4d2af1540c72857ec87ef7466e446de07f OP_EQUALVERIFY OP_CHECKSIG
- address
- 173jKgA6GAXUh31RiBm3xauzP5RmQTNmmU